WebMicah was a contemporary of the prophet Isaiah. The book’s superscription ( 1:1) places his prophetic activity during the reigns of three kings of Judah: Jotham, Ahaz, and Hezekiah. It identifies him as a resident of Moresheth, a village in the Judean foothills.
